Logo of Huzzle

Flagship Store Manager

  • Job
    Full-time
    Mid & Senior Level
  • Customer Relations

AI generated summary

  • You need beauty retail experience, excellent planning, data-driven decision-making, coaching skills, strong communication, leadership, good IT proficiency, and flexibility to work any day of the week.
  • You will lead the team to achieve sales targets, drive customer engagement, manage stock, analyze data for decisions, communicate effectively, and develop staff while fostering brand loyalty.

Requirements

  • Experience in beauty retail and people leadership
  • Able to control and meet sales and performance targets with outstanding planning and organising skills
  • Experience of using data provided to make sound commercial and business decisions
  • Ability to work collaboratively within a feedback culture
  • Team coaching and development
  • Ability to demonstrate outstanding communication and operational skills
  • Leadership skills to achieve personal and business success
  • Good IT Skills
  • Flexibility to work across Sunday to Saturday is required

Responsibilities

  • To be an inspirational leader with enthusiasm for our brand and believe in the way we do business.
  • With beauty retail expertise that is second to none, you will drive the store and the team to deliver retail excellence, strong sales results and engaging customer experience.
  • We want someone who will shape a customer focused store experience by leading the team to drive customer engagement and bring the brand to life.
  • The Store manager should also ensure the development of consumer loyalty to help build The Body Shop brand.
  • We’re looking for someone who will be able to control and meet sales and performance targets with outstanding planning and organising skills.
  • Our Store Managers need to have exceptional stock management skills, and the ability to monitor/manage change.
  • It is essential for our Store Managers to be confident to use the data we provide you with to make sound commercial and business decisions to really drive your sales and your people.
  • Our Store Manager have to have full knowledge of the beauty market, our competitors and have passion and love for our products!
  • We’re particularly interested in individuals who are able to lead and work as part of a team and can quickly react to any problems that may occur.
  • There is a necessity for our managers to be outstanding communicators and competent to manage the team in accordance to the needs of the store and its customers.
  • We desire a flexible and responsible role model who is capable of attracting and retaining people who reflect the brand.
  • Managers must have the ability to identify high potential, develop current members of the team to a high standard.

FAQs

What is the main responsibility of a Flagship Store Manager at The Body Shop?

The main responsibility is to be an inspirational leader who drives retail excellence, strong sales results, and an engaging customer experience while embodying the brand's values.

Is experience in beauty retail required for this role?

Yes, experience in beauty retail and people leadership is essential for this role.

What skills are necessary for managing a store effectively?

Necessary skills include outstanding planning and organizing, stock management, and exceptional communication and operational abilities.

Will I need to work weekends?

Yes, flexibility to work across Sunday to Saturday is required.

How important is team management in this position?

Team management is very important, as the role requires leading, coaching, and developing team members to reflect the brand's values.

What qualities does The Body Shop look for in a candidate?

The Body Shop looks for qualities such as leadership skills, commerciality, collaborative skills, outstanding communication, operational skills, and a commitment to purpose.

How does The Body Shop measure success in this role?

Success is measured through meeting sales and performance targets, driving customer engagement, and developing a loyal customer base.

What kind of decisions will the Store Manager need to make?

The Store Manager will need to make sound commercial and business decisions based on the data provided to drive sales and manage the team effectively.

Are there opportunities for professional development within this role?

Yes, there are opportunities for professional development, particularly in team coaching and identifying high-potential individuals within the team.

Is a good understanding of the beauty market required for this position?

Yes, a full knowledge of the beauty market and competitors is essential for success in this role.

Fighting for a Fairer and More Beautiful World

Retail & Consumer Goods
Industry
10,001+
Employees
1976
Founded Year

Mission & Purpose

The Body Shop International Limited is the original natural and ethical beauty brand. Our heritage is an amazing story of firsts. The first to create Body Butter, the first to use manmade musk in fragrance rather than cruelly-extracted deer musk, the first to transform the beauty industry with fair trade ingredients. For 40 years The Body Shop showed the world that business could be a force for good, anchored in Anita Roddick’s pioneering approach to doing business. Our Commitment for the next 40 years, Enrich Not Exploit™, has three elements: Enrich Our People - Enrich Our Planet - Enrich Our Products. We exist to make a positive difference to people’s lives. We create superior quality products using the world’s finest natural ingredients to make your skin feel so good. We have over 3000 stores in 68 countries, and reach out to customers around the world through launching e-commerce sites, opening sub-franchise businesses and identifying selective wholesale in new markets plus adding new Global Travel Retail locations around the world. Our people are passionate, independent, diverse individuals.